Submitted by Captain Kwok on Wed, 2007-03-14 10:57.

The "Upgrade All" button will do this for at least facilities that are queued. It's harder to program this for ships/units because they are not just "higher levels" of tech like a facility, but actually distinct items and don't contain a direct reference to a predecessor design. Also, since players don't always use the same naming conventions for upgrades or one design per design type, there's no hard and fast rule that could be used with design names/types. Now I suppose a variable could be introduced for a design that would contain the design id of it's predecessor if the "update" button is used to create the design. Otherwise it would return 0 and would not affected by the "Upgrade All" button.

Submitted by MisterBenn on Fri, 2007-03-16 11:57.

You can get close to a couple of these requests with a bit of experimenting.

As Kwok and Grumble mention above, going to Empire Options and selecting "Prev/Next Buttons skip ships in fleets" is a good thing to be doing to stay on top of your ships' orders.

Keeping track of huge masses of ships I find easiest via the Ships list screen, with a custom layout consisting of Ship Image, Ship Class, Ship Fleet Name, Damage, Movement, Orders. I use Ship Class rather than name since the Class gets updated and the Name does not during retrofitting. Sorted by Fleet this list gives a pretty good overview of what state a large force of ships is in. Man, I wish these Custom Lists could be saved to a file!

Regarding the Colony in a Can request, if you enable the Planetary Construction Minister in the Empire Options, the planet will auto build facilities according to its designated Colony Type if you leave the queue empty. As you might expect it's not as efficient as taking care of it manually... from my experience the minister will add just one facility at a time, even if more than one could be built within a turn, and choices of building may not coincide with what you desire (such as excessive Resupply Depots within a system, or storage facilities when you want as many extractors as possible. Still, if you are blitzing out with 45 colony ships at once, you may find this useful!

I think there's an argument to compile some of the control tips into a central list. The controls are very open ended there are several controls which are only found by the sharp eye! A couple of weeks ago I saw for the first time that the Construction Queue Options window could be scrolled, and that options for "Automatically send ships built to way point" buttons were underneath Emergency Build and Pause Construction!!!
